Elizabeth buys some apples and oranges.
Weight of apples = 3.37 kg
Weight of oranges =1.24 kg
∴ Total weight of the purchse = (3.37 + 1.24) kg
We can use blocks, rods, and flats to represent hundredths, tenths and ones respectively, which are as follows:
![](https://df0b18phdhzpx.cloudfront.net/ckeditor_assets/pictures/1190443/original_Screenshot_2021-06-18_at_6.26.21_PM.png)
Following this representation, 3.37 can be expressed as:
![](https://df0b18phdhzpx.cloudfront.net/ckeditor_assets/pictures/1190447/original_Screenshot_2021-06-18_at_6.27.06_PM.png)
Similarly, 1.24 can be expressed as:
![](https://df0b18phdhzpx.cloudfront.net/ckeditor_assets/pictures/1190449/original_Screenshot_2021-06-18_at_6.27.51_PM.png)
Now, to calculate 3.37 + 1.24, we write the decimals one below the other and add them as follows:
![](https://df0b18phdhzpx.cloudfront.net/ckeditor_assets/pictures/1190450/original_Screenshot_2021-06-18_at_6.28.34_PM.png)
As we can see, the answer of the sum has 4 flats, 5 rods, and 11 blocks
But we can express 10 blocks as 1 rod.
So, 11 blocks can be expressed as:
11 blocks = (10 + 1) blocks
= 1 rod + 1 block
So, we observe:
![](https://df0b18phdhzpx.cloudfront.net/ckeditor_assets/pictures/1190452/original_Screenshot_2021-06-18_at_6.29.22_PM.png)
Rearranging 11 blocks into 1 rod and 1 block, we get:
![](https://df0b18phdhzpx.cloudfront.net/ckeditor_assets/pictures/1177572/original_Screenshot_2021-06-12_at_3.20.26_AM.png)
Counting the final number of flats, rods, and blocks, we get 4 flats, 6 rods, and 1 block.
∴ The total weight of the purchase
is
$4.61 kg.
